Head Lice
There have been a number of cases of head lice within the school over the past number of months. We would request that, if you receive a letter advising you of an outbreak in your child's class, you treat your child immediately as a preventative measure. Head lice can spread rapidly within a school unless all affected children are promptly treated. Delay in identifying and treating all affected children can result in a cycle of repeated infestation with treated children rapidly becoming reinfected. Thank you for your cooperation in this matter.
